Workshop: Shaping the future of One Health research at SLU

Help us identify important future One Health areas where different SLU competences should join forces. On April 16th, SLU Future One Health will arrange a workshop to pinpoint complex challenges that require an interdisciplinary One Health approach, and where SLU research has the potential to make a difference.

When? 16 April, 9.00-12.00

Who? SLU researchers and PhD students interested in developing interdisciplinary SLU One Health research

Why? To guide decisions on future research support activities and to promote SLU One Health networking
